The Rich History of Indian Food



Although many individuals associate Indian food with its varied flavors and lively seasonings, its background is deeply rooted in the subcontinent's cultural advancement. The culinary practices of India date back thousands of years, influenced by different civilizations such as the Indus Valley, Maurya, and Gupta realms (fresh kebabs). Ancient texts, consisting of the Vedas and Ayurvedic bibles, highlight the relevance of food in medical and religious techniques


Trade paths promoted the exchange of components and methods, introducing items like rice, spices, and lentils. The arrival of international rulers, such as the Mughals, additionally enriched the food, including Persian and Main Asian components. Regional variants emerged, showing social practices and neighborhood resources, resulting in the advancement of distinctive cooking designs. On the whole, the history of Indian food is a tapestry woven from social exchanges, regional adjustments, and significant historic occasions, making it a representation of the subcontinent's diverse heritage.

Regional Variations and Influences



The diversity of North Indian cuisine reflects a tapestry of regional variants and social influences. Each state supplies renowned meals that showcase neighborhood ingredients and practices. For example, Punjabi food is renowned for its rich, buttery recipes like Butter Poultry and Sarson da Saag, while the Awadhi style from Uttar Pradesh highlights slow-cooked biryanis and kebabs. In the mountainous regions, dishes like Rajma (kidney beans) from Himachal Pradesh highlight using basic, wholesome active ingredients. The influence of Mughal cooking traditions is apparent in meals like Biryani and Nihari, which include fragrant flavors and cooking strategies. This regional kaleidoscope shows how culture, background, and geography assemble to develop a lively North Indian culinary landscape.


Flavors of South India: A Culinary Trip



While discovering Indian cuisine, one can not neglect the diverse and vivid flavors of South India, where each meal narrates of custom and social heritage. This area, encompassing states like Tamil Nadu, Kerala, Karnataka, and Andhra Pradesh, offers a rich tapestry of cooking thrills. Popular staples consist of dosa, a fermented rice and lentil crepe, and idli, a soft fit to be tied rice cake, frequently come with by coconut chutney and sambar, a spicy lentil soup. The usage of rice as a key grain mirrors the farming bounty of the land. Furthermore, South Indian cuisine is known for its unique mix of vegetarian and seafood recipes, affected by seaside geography. The elaborate preparation approaches and local specializeds, such as Kerala's fish curry and Andhra's spicy biryani, highlight the area's culinary variety. Each meal is not just food yet an experience, deeply rooted in the social practices and celebrations of the South.


The Seasoning Scheme: Key Ingredients in Indian Cooking



Understanding Indian cooking requires a recognition of its detailed flavor palette, which functions as the foundation for its distinctive flavors. Central to this palette are spices such as cumin, coriander, cardamom, and turmeric, each contributing one-of-a-kind scents and tastes. Cumin, with its earthy notes, is frequently made use of in both entire and ground kinds, while coriander seeds lend a citrusy touch. Turmeric, recognized for its vibrant yellow shade, gives heat and is famous for its health advantages. Cardamom, understood for its wonderful and spicy scent, is important in both mouthwatering dishes and desserts. Various other key ingredients consist of mustard seeds, fenugreek, and chili peppers, which present varying levels of warmth and intricacy. The harmonious mix of these flavors, often matched by fresh herbs like cilantro and mint, creates the abundant tapestry of flavors that identify Indian cuisine, elevating it to a cookery form valued worldwide.
